We are still in the dark ages, though. Just consider: this "bulb" has to plug into the standard 110/230V AC electrical sockets. Powering an LED is nothing like powering an incandescent bulb: you need a constant current driver delivering a precisely measured DC current that, depending on the LED, is between 300mA and (say) 1.5A.
